系统概念数据库包括什么
-
系统概念数据库是指用于描述和管理系统概念的一种数据库。它是由一系列相互关联的表和模型组成的,用于存储和管理系统中的各种概念和关系。系统概念数据库包括以下几个方面:
-
实体和属性:系统概念数据库中的实体是指系统中的各种元素或对象,如人员、设备、部门等。每个实体都有一组属性,用于描述该实体的特征和属性。例如,一个人员实体可以有姓名、年龄、性别等属性。
-
关系和连接:系统概念数据库中的实体之间存在各种关系和连接。关系可以是一对一、一对多或多对多的关系。连接则是指通过共同的属性将不同实体关联起来。例如,一个部门实体和一个员工实体可以通过员工所在的部门属性进行连接。
-
概念层次结构:系统概念数据库可以使用概念层次结构来组织和管理不同实体之间的关系。概念层次结构是一种树状结构,其中每个节点表示一个概念,而边表示概念之间的继承关系。例如,一个人员概念可以派生出经理和员工两个子概念。
-
约束和规则:系统概念数据库可以定义各种约束和规则,以确保数据的完整性和一致性。约束可以限制属性的取值范围,规定实体之间的关系等。例如,一个约束可以规定员工的年龄必须大于等于18岁。
-
查询和操作:系统概念数据库提供了各种查询和操作功能,用于检索和修改数据库中的数据。查询可以通过指定条件来检索符合条件的实体,操作可以对数据库中的数据进行增删改操作。例如,可以查询年龄大于30岁的员工,或者将某个员工的薪资调整为指定的数值。
总之,系统概念数据库是一种用于描述和管理系统概念的数据库,包括实体和属性、关系和连接、概念层次结构、约束和规则,以及查询和操作功能。通过使用系统概念数据库,可以更好地组织和管理系统中的各种概念和关系,提高数据的管理和使用效率。
1年前 -
-
数据库是一个用来存储和管理数据的系统。它可以理解为一个组织化的数据集合,其中包含了一系列的数据和数据之间的关系。数据库系统的目标是提供一种高效、可靠、安全地存储和检索数据的方式。
数据库系统包括以下几个主要的组成部分:
-
数据库管理系统(DBMS):数据库管理系统是数据库系统的核心组件,它负责管理数据库中的数据、存储和检索数据、处理用户的请求等。常见的数据库管理系统包括MySQL、Oracle、SQL Server等。
-
数据库:数据库是存储数据的容器,它可以理解为一个文件夹,其中包含了一系列的数据表。每个数据库可以包含多个数据表,每个数据表又由多个行和列组成,用于存储具体的数据。
-
数据表:数据表是数据库中的一种数据结构,它由多个行和列组成。每一行表示一个记录,每一列表示一个字段。数据表用于组织和存储数据,每个数据表都有一个唯一的表名。
-
数据字段:数据字段是数据表中的一个列,它用于存储特定类型的数据。每个数据字段都有一个字段名和字段类型,字段类型可以是整数、浮点数、字符串等。
-
数据记录:数据记录是数据表中的一行,它表示数据库中的一个实体或对象。每个数据记录包含了一系列的数据字段,用于存储该实体或对象的属性值。
-
数据关系:数据关系是数据库中不同数据表之间的联系。通过数据关系,可以实现数据表之间的查询和连接操作。常见的数据关系有主键-外键关系、一对一关系、一对多关系和多对多关系等。
总之,数据库系统包括数据库管理系统、数据库、数据表、数据字段、数据记录和数据关系等几个重要的组成部分。它们共同协作,提供了一个高效、可靠地存储和管理数据的方式。
1年前 -
-
系统概念数据库(System Concept Database)是一种用于存储和管理系统概念的数据库。它是对系统概念进行组织和管理的工具,可以帮助用户更好地理解和应用系统概念。系统概念数据库包括以下几个方面的内容:
-
实体(Entities):实体是系统中具有独立存在和唯一标识的对象。在系统概念数据库中,实体被用来表示系统中的各种对象,如人、物、地点、事件等。每个实体都有一组属性来描述其特征和状态。
-
属性(Attributes):属性是用来描述实体特征和状态的信息。在系统概念数据库中,每个实体都有一组属性,每个属性都有一个名字和一个数据类型。属性可以是简单属性,也可以是复合属性。
-
关系(Relationships):关系是实体之间的联系。在系统概念数据库中,关系用来表示实体之间的相关性。关系可以是一对一、一对多或多对多的关系。每个关系都有一个名字和一个关系类型。
-
约束(Constraints):约束是对数据的限制和规定。在系统概念数据库中,约束用来确保数据的一致性和完整性。常见的约束包括主键约束、外键约束、唯一约束、检查约束等。
-
视图(Views):视图是对数据库中数据的逻辑展示。在系统概念数据库中,视图可以用来简化数据访问和操作。视图可以是基于一个或多个表的查询结果,也可以是对表的子集或衍生表的定义。
-
查询(Queries):查询是对数据库中数据的检索和操作。在系统概念数据库中,查询可以用来获取所需的数据,也可以用来更新和删除数据。查询可以通过使用结构化查询语言(SQL)来实现。
-
安全性(Security):安全性是保护数据库中数据的机制。在系统概念数据库中,安全性包括对用户的身份验证和授权管理,以及对数据的访问控制和审计跟踪。
总之,系统概念数据库包括实体、属性、关系、约束、视图、查询和安全性等方面的内容,通过对这些内容的组织和管理,可以更好地理解和应用系统概念。
1年前 -